WebGrowing Pains 1874-1895. Winston Leonard Spencer Churchill was born 30 November 1874 at Blenheim Palace, the ancestral home of the Dukes of Marlborough. His father, second son of the 7th Duke of Marlborough, inherited neither title nor property. Winston grew up with social status, privilege, and a keen sense of heritage, but little money.
